TAMUmpower wrote: h18 just has a post with a hole in the end that you pin to the mast fitting Just to clarify, there is a hinge fitting that goes between the "post" on the boom and the mast fitting (shown on page 15 of the assembly manual). If you were to pin the post on the boom directly to the mast fitting, you would almost certainly break the gooseneck. https://static.hobiecat.com/digital_assets/H18%26SX_Manual.pdf?_ga=2.139414515.1740873645.1527609468-2078875715.1490016879 sm |

The gooseneck pin is readily available from any Hobie dealer. To replace it, you'll need to drill out the rivets in the end of the boom, remove the cap, install the new gooseneck, and then re-rivet the end cap to the boom. http://www.backyardboats.com/mm5/mercha ... e=10772010 The gooseneck yoke http://www.backyardboats.com/mm5/mercha ... e=60710000 and the vertex http://www.backyardboats.com/mm5/mercha ... e=50772031 are both also readily available, if you need them. |
